Title: Re: About a car on ebay
Post by: joshwyatt on 07 February 2010, 20:35:30
You use the registration id tag at the start of the plate to help you out. For instance from 2002 to 2006 the majority of Metropolitan police vehicles all started with LX, LV, LY then changing to BU after mid 2006. And Thames Valley Police on marked vehicles and most unmarked from 2001 to present start with OU, OY, OV. PN is from Preston, so the car was first registered there and was in service with Lancarshire police.
